Effnet Non-3GPP Access represents a significant leap forward in the realm of seamless 5G connectivity. This innovative solution, available for both network and terminal sides, plays a crucial role in enabling 5G networks to seamlessly connect with non-traditional networks outside the realm of 3GPP standards, including Wi-Fi, satellite, and wireline networks.

As the demand for ubiquitous 5G coverage continues to soar, the integration of Non-3GPP Access into 5G networks has become imperative for service providers striving to deliver uninterrupted, high-quality service across diverse environments. Effnet's latest offering directly addresses this need by facilitating smooth and secure connectivity between 5G networks and various Non-3GPP access technologies, such as Wi-Fi, satellite, and wireline networks.
